- 常用函数
- 遍历方法
头文件:#include “set”
定义:set s;
特性:set中元素是唯一并且有序性的(会自动排序)。
s.insert(x); //向s中插入元素x,插入位置为最后 s.count(x); //元素x出现的次数:0/1 s.begin(); //返回set容器的第一个迭代器 s.end() //返回set容器的最后一个迭代器 s.clear() //删除set容器中的所有的元素 s.empty() //判断set容器是否为空 s.max_size() //返回set容器可能包含的元素最大个数 s.size() //返回当前set容器中的元素个数 s.rbegin //返回的值和end()相同 s.rend() //返回的值和rbegin()相同遍历方法
set::iterator iter; for(iter = s.begin() ; iter != s.end() ; ++iter) { cout<<*iter<<" "; }



